Roofers install and repair roofing systems at height, from small domestic repairs to large commercial or new-build projects. They measure materials, read drawings, and work outdoors across different sites. Apprentices can specialise in slating/tiling, waterproof membranes, or sheeting and cladding.

How to prepare for a job interview at Skill Up Somerset

Know Your Roofing Basics

Before heading into the interview, brush up on your knowledge of roofing systems. Understand the different types of materials used, like slating, tiling, and waterproof membranes. This will show your potential employer that you're genuinely interested in the trade and ready to learn.

Show Off Your Practical Skills

Since this role is hands-on, be prepared to discuss any relevant experience you have. If you've done any DIY projects or helped out with roofing work before, share those stories! Employers love to hear about practical skills and how you’ve applied them in real situations.

Ask Smart Questions

Prepare a few questions to ask during the interview. Inquire about the types of projects you might work on or what specialisation opportunities are available. This not only shows your enthusiasm but also hel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.

Dress for the Job

Even though it’s a hands-on role, make sure to dress appropriately for the interview. Opt for smart-casual attire that reflects your professionalism while still being practical. This will help create a good first impression and show that you take the opportunity seriously.
